Aug 3, 2022 · Frida Kahlo, Her Photos. Frida Kahlo, by Guillermo Kahlo, 1932 Diego Rivera & Frida Kahlo Archives. Frida Kahlo, Her Photos comes from the archive of photographs that belonged to her personally and which were largely unknown. They are now grouped together thematically into six sections by a renowned Mexican photographer, curator and historian ... Jun 16, 2021 ... The National Museum of Mexican Art in Chicago, IL is a vibrant cultural institution dedicated to showcasing the rich diversity of Mexican art and heritage. Through a wide range of programs and exhibitions, the museum celebrates Mexican cultural expressions from ancient to modern times, representing the Mexican community with its own unique voice. In 1982, Carlos Tortolero organized a group of fellow educators and founded the Mexican Fine Arts Center Museum, which opened its doors in 1987. The goal was to establish an arts and cultural organization committed to accessibility, education and social justice. The museum also provided a positive influence for the local Mexican ...
